Stratco is a proudly Australian-owned business with over 75 years of excellence in innovation, manufacturing, and customer service within the building industry.
With an expanding presence across Australia, New Zealand, and select international markets, Stratco is committed to delivering high-quality products, trusted partnerships and exceptional customer experiences.We have an prospect for an experienced Logistics Administrator based at Ormeau.
This is a permanent, full-time position.Ready to roll up your sleeves and be part of something that gets made?
This isn't just another admin role – it's a chance to be on the floor where things happen, where teamwork drives results, and where your hard work shows at the end of every shift.ResponsibilitiesPreparing and managing daily truck manifests and despatch documentationResponding to general despatch enquiries from internal stakeholdersManaging incoming calls and assisting with operational coordinationCommunicating customer and operational issues across relevant departmentsPreparing operational reports and performance data for managementSupporting safety, compliance and quality auditsMaintaining accurate records and administration systemsMonitoring outstanding documentation and following up required actionsSupporting driver onboarding and induction administrationEnsuring compliance with company policies and workplace safety requirementsIdentifying process gaps and supporting continuous improvement initiativesGeneral housekeeping dutiesStrict adherence to critical safety rules and contributing to a safe working environmentAbout youYou are a proactive administrator who enjoys working in a busy operational environment and takes pride in accuracy and attention to detail.You will ideally have:Previous experience in logistics, transport, warehouse or manufacturing administrationStrong administrative and organisational skillsExcellent attention to detail and data accuracyStrong written and verbal communication skillsIntermediate Microsoft Office skills, particularly ExcelExperience preparing reports and maintaining operational recordsThe ability to manage competing priorities and meet deadlinesA collaborative approach and strong customer service mindsetExperience working within a safety-focused environmentExperience with transport, freight, warehouse management or ERP systems will be highly regarded.Life at Stratco includes...Holistic Wellness and Mental Health Support24/7 EAP to team members and familyFlexible Working ArrangementsTeam Member DiscountsProfessional Development and Career GrowthCompetitive RemunerationPositive Workplace Culture and InclusionAt Stratco, manufacturing is our foundation, but our people are our future.
We empower our team to grow and succeed, within an inclusive and collaborative environment, where every individual matters, and innovation thrives.At Stratco, Safety is paramount, and we take every measure to ensure our team members 'Return Home Safe'.
To see more information about Stratco and our careers please visit stratco.com.au/careersPlease note, as part of our standard recruitment process, candidates are required to undergo a pre-employment medical and drug and alcohol screening, as well as obtain a National Police Clearance.
